LED Sensor Lights – Smart Motion Activated Lighting Solution for Energy Efficient Illumination Systems

LED sensor lights are advanced intelligent lighting devices that combine energy-efficient LED technology with motion sensing and ambient light detection systems. They are designed to automatically turn on when movement is detected and turn off when no activity is present, providing both convenience and significant energy savings. These lighting solutions are widely used in residential homes, commercial buildings, industrial facilities, outdoor security systems, and public infrastructure.
The core technology of LED sensor lights relies on integrated motion sensors, typically infrared (PIR sensors) or microwave radar sensors. PIR sensors detect infrared radiation emitted by human bodies, triggering the light when someone enters the detection zone. Microwave sensors, on the other hand, emit high-frequency electromagnetic waves and detect motion through reflected signal changes, offering higher sensitivity and wider coverage. Some advanced models combine both technologies for improved accuracy and reduced false triggering.
One of the major advantages of LED sensor lights is their energy efficiency. Since the lights only operate when needed, they significantly reduce electricity consumption compared to traditional always-on lighting systems. This makes them an environmentally friendly and cost-effective solution for both residential and commercial users. The LED light source itself consumes very low power while providing high brightness output, further enhancing overall efficiency.
LED sensor lights are widely used in various applications. In residential environments, they are commonly installed in hallways, staircases, bathrooms, garages, and entrances to provide automatic lighting and improve safety at night. In commercial and industrial settings, they are used in warehouses, parking lots, office corridors, and storage areas to ensure visibility while minimizing energy waste. Outdoor applications include garden lighting, street lighting, security lighting, and building perimeter illumination.
Another important feature of LED sensor lights is their long lifespan. High-quality LED chips can last over 30,000 to 50,000 hours, depending on usage conditions. Combined with durable housing materials such as aluminum alloy or high-strength plastic, these lights are resistant to heat, corrosion, and harsh weather conditions. This makes them suitable for both indoor and outdoor environments.
Modern LED sensor lights often come with adjustable settings, allowing users to customize detection range, light sensitivity, and delay time. This flexibility ensures optimal performance in different environments. For example, in low-traffic areas, a longer delay time can reduce frequent switching, while in high-traffic areas, shorter response times improve efficiency.
Installation of LED sensor lights is generally simple and does not require complex wiring or professional tools in many models. They can be wall-mounted, ceiling-mounted, or integrated into existing lighting systems. Some advanced versions also support solar power, making them ideal for off-grid or outdoor applications where wiring is difficult.
In terms of design, LED sensor lights are available in various shapes and styles, including round, square, panel-type, floodlight-type, and decorative designs. This allows them to blend seamlessly into different architectural environments while maintaining functionality. Waterproof and dustproof ratings such as IP65 or IP66 are commonly available for outdoor models, ensuring reliable performance under rain, dust, and extreme weather conditions.
Safety is another key benefit of LED sensor lights. Automatic illumination helps prevent accidents in dark areas, deters intruders in security applications, and improves visibility in emergency situations. This makes them an important component of modern smart home and smart building systems.
As smart technology continues to develop, LED sensor lights are increasingly integrated with IoT systems and smart home platforms. Users can control lighting remotely through mobile apps, voice assistants, or automated schedules, further enhancing convenience and energy management capabilities.
